Output de5986da5097d11c6db0ef6e16b5b9742560026a03257ca43d7f78144cd3c04c:2

value
19260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ed221478415cef518f5acc7babd9c724889d022a OP_EQUAL
address
3PJrtvavMpqeX6ijzSeWsY4YY3HTjgivF4
transaction
de5986da5097d11c6db0ef6e16b5b9742560026a03257ca43d7f78144cd3c04c
spent
true